What is Oil-Free Fermentation?
At its core, this preservation method is known as lacto-fermentation. The 'oil-free' aspect isn't a modern modification but a fundamental feature of the process. It works by using salt and water to create an environment where beneficial, naturally occurring
bacteria called Lactobacillus can thrive. These microorganisms are already present on the surface of fresh vegetables. When submerged in a saltwater brine without oxygen, these friendly bacteria begin to convert the natural sugars in the vegetables into lactic acid. This acid is a natural preservative that lowers the pH of the food, preventing the growth of harmful spoilage bacteria. Unlike pickling, which relies on adding an acid like vinegar, fermentation creates its own protective, acidic environment, all without a single drop of oil.
The Power of Friendly Bacteria
The 'friendly bacteria' in the headline are probiotics, and they are one of the biggest benefits of eating fermented foods. This process doesn't just preserve your vegetables; it transforms them into a functional food that can support your health. These live microorganisms are celebrated for their role in promoting good gut health. A healthy gut microbiome is linked to improved digestion, a stronger immune system, and overall wellness. The lactic acid created during fermentation also helps create an environment in the digestive tract where these healthy bacteria can flourish. Incredibly, fermentation can also unlock and increase the availability of certain nutrients in vegetables, making them even more beneficial than when they were raw.
Getting Started: What You'll Need
The beauty of fermentation lies in its simplicity. You don't need a lab full of expensive equipment. The basic tools are likely already in your kitchen. First, you'll need glass jars with lids. Mason jars are a popular choice. Second, you need a way to keep the vegetables submerged under the brine, as exposure to air can cause problems. This can be a special fermentation weight, a smaller jar filled with water, or even a clean stone. Third, you need salt, but not just any salt. Use an unrefined salt like sea salt or kosher salt that is free of iodine and anti-caking agents, as these can interfere with the fermentation process. Finally, you'll need filtered or spring water, as the chlorine in some tap water can inhibit the good bacteria.
A Simple Guide to Your First Ferment
Ready to try? Start with clean hands, equipment, and fresh, well-washed produce. Chop or shred your vegetables and pack them tightly into your jar. Next, prepare your brine. A general rule of thumb is about 1 to 2 tablespoons of salt per litre of water. Pour the brine over the vegetables, leaving about an inch of headspace at the top. The most crucial step is to ensure all the vegetables are fully submerged beneath the liquid. Use your weight to hold everything down. Loosely seal the jar and place it on a tray to catch any overflow, which is common as the fermentation produces gas. Store it at a cool room temperature, ideally between 68 and 72 degrees Fahrenheit, away from direct sunlight.
Patience Is the Final Ingredient
For the next few days, you will need to 'burp' the jar daily by briefly loosening the lid to release built-up carbon dioxide. You'll soon see bubbles rising, and the brine may turn cloudy – these are signs that your friendly bacteria are hard at work. The fermentation time can range from a few days to a few weeks, depending on the vegetable and ambient temperature. Taste it periodically. When it reaches a tangy flavour that you enjoy, the ferment is ready. Transfer the jar to the refrigerator with a tight lid. The cold temperature will dramatically slow the fermentation process, allowing you to enjoy your preserved vegetables for several weeks or even months.
